BACKGROUND
The Town's Capital Improvement Program includes Camino Ramon Improvements, CIP
No. C-601. This project is located on Camino Ramon from Kelley Lane to Fostoria Way
and will provide roadway paving improvements, sidewalk at bus stop locations,
pedestrian crossing improvements, high -visibility bike lane and crosswalk striping
marking upgrades, and traffic signal video detection and pedestrian signal upgrades.
DISCUSSION
The Town has previously established a Quality Assurance Program (QAP), a sampling
and testing program that will provide assurance that the materials and workmanship
incorporated into each construction project is in conformance with the contract
specifications. Some of the testing includes hot mix asphalt (HMA) materials, soils, and
aggregate base compaction. Field testing will be performed in accordance with AASHTO
(American Association of State Highway and Transportation Officials), ASTM (American
Society of Testing and Measurement), or Caltrans (CT) standards.
In accordance with the Town's QAP, a materials laboratory is required to perform
acceptance testing on Federal -aid and other designated projects. The materials laboratory
shall be under the responsible management of a California registered Engineer with
experience in sampling, inspection, and testing of construction materials. The Engineer
shall certify the results of all tests performed by laboratory personnel under the
Engineer's supervision. The materials laboratory shall contain certified test equipment
capable of performing the tests conforming to the provisions of this QAP.
At this time, there is a need for laboratory and field testing services during the
construction phase for Camino Ramon Improvements, CIP No. C-601. On May 25, 2023,
ENGEO submitted a proposal with a not to exceed budget of $57,900 to provide the
desired laboratory and field testing services.

FISCAL IMPACT
The amount for the professional services agreement for laboratory and field testing
services during construction is $57,900. An additional 10% contingency in the amount of
$5,790 will be reserved for a laboratory and field testing services budget of $63,690.
Sufficient funds to cover the environmental services contract and contingency are
contained in Camino Ramon Improvements, CIP No. C-601 (Attachment B).
